SOCALKEN, May 10, 2009 #1 SOCALKEN Thread Starter Joined: Aug 7, 2005 Messages: 37 Found the solution at: http://support.microsoft.com/kb/908077 Three fixes are discussed but the one that worked for me was as follows : 1.Unregister Windows Installer. To do this, click Start, click Run, type msiexec /unregister in the Open box, and then click OK. 2. Reregister Windows Installer. To do this, click click Start, click Run, type msiexec /regserver in the Open box, and then click OK.
